Brewery Worker’s Prank Leads to the Recall of 200,000 Cans of Beer
When playing a prank goes horribly wrong at most places of business, it leads termination or if you're lucky a slap on the wrist. This brewer's prank lead to 200,000 cans of beer being recalled and he was named "Employee of the Month."
Graeme Wallace is the packing manager for BrewDog and he did not think that the UK company was being 'punk' enough. Wallace changed the wording on a batch of Punk IPA to read "MOTHER F****R DAY". The 200,000 cans that were shipped out had to be recalled.
A BrewDog spokesperson said, "At another company, someone responsible for a prank like this might have been given the heave ho. At BrewDog, Graeme was awarded Employee of the Month."
